Tim invites Gina to move in with him and when Sally phones home, Gina plays her and Tim off against each other. At the Street Cars Christmas party at the Bisto with Eileen, Steve and Tracy, Tim hits the bottle. A drunk Tim angrily declares his wife did the dirty so it’s time he did the same and Gina enters and listens, intrigued.
After being kicked out of the Bistro, Tim stands atop the fire escape on Victoria Street singing carols and Gina climbs up to fetch him down. An emotional Tim admits he misses Sally but back at No.4, a maudlin Tim thanks Gina for being there and plants a kiss on her.
Meanwhile, Johnny’s shocked by Jenny’s black eye while Gemma is suspicious of the facial marking. Later as Jenny and Johnny row about Liz, Jenny misses her footing and falls down the stairs.
Elsewhere, Eileen’s taken aback when Seb explains that as he can’t adopt the twins until he’s 21 he needs her to apply for joint guardianship with him; Sally tries to encourage Abi to stay on the straight and narrow; and Cathy begs Yasmeen to give Brian this year’s Father Christmas role at the Community Centre to boost his confidence.

Mick struggles to get back to normality and despite being back with Linda, he only has one thing on his mind – revenge.
Jean accidentally throws away her medication. The Slaters sense that something is amiss with Jean, unaware that she is struggling with Hayley’s secret and running the choir. Stacey turns to Max for advice and later makes a worrying discovery.
Meanwhile, Karen and Kim compete for the solo spot and feeling the pressure, Jean makes a snap decision. Later, Jean is excited when she finds a Christmas present from Ian.

Flashbacks to Christmas 1986 reveal the start of killer Breda’s murderous ways.
As the McQueens come together for Christmas dinner things are tense between Goldie and Mercedes, and Mercedes soon snaps and dumps the contents of a gravy boat on Goldie’s bonce. There are more shocks to come when the police arrive with an announcement about Russ’ killer. Is everyone about to discover it was Sylver’s mum Breda who bumped him off?
Elsewhere, Lily drags Prince to the hospital to find out his results; Grace forces a downbeat Liam to celebrate Christmas with her and Curtis but it all goes wrong.

Zara confides in Emma that she is worried that Daniel might not come back this time. Emma convinces Zara to come out to the party, though Zara is reluctant at first. Zara is touched when Valerie tells her that she has managed to get hold of a present that Joe wants.
Valerie gathers announces that the new party plan is a pub crawl with a Christmas hats theme. Al is about to back out when Zara, still thankful to Valerie, steps in and insists he come. Drinks are on her and Daniel. As the evening goes on, slowly people drop out until eventually Sid and Zara are left alone.
After sharing a taxi, Sid finds himself in Zara’s hallway, a bit tipsy. She is in a playful mood, and reveals Joe isn’t here and that Daniel has left. She teases him, and then kisses him. They disappear upstairs.
Elsewhere, Laura tells Ruhma that she is pregnant and would like to accept the loan; Gordon helps Mrs Tembe see a way through her crisis of faith, and they have a heart to heart about the past.
